Did you really think you could do this without us Rose?

It is a confrontational way to say the other person was arrogant or mistaken about succeeding alone.

From Blood Contract, Episode 47

When do people say this?

Scene Context

Someone challenges another person for thinking they could succeed without support.

Usage Scenario

Use this in arguments or dramatic scenes when criticizing someone’s confidence. It sounds accusatory and not polite.
